Freightliner Cascadia Day Cab Chassis from Mexico
A heavy-duty diesel cab chassis from Freightliner with a GVW of 15 tons, designed for mounting cargo bodies like flatbeds or dump trucks. It features a compression-ignition engine and includes the cab but no pre-installed cargo area, classifying it under HTS 8704.22.11 as a cab chassis for goods transport vehicles over 5 but not exceeding 20 metric tons.

Import Tips
• Verify GVW certification from manufacturer to confirm 5-20 ton range and diesel engine type for accurate HTS classification
• Obtain EPA and DOT compliance documents for engine emissions and safety standards prior to U.S. entry
• Avoid misclassification as complete truck by ensuring no cargo body is attached; declare as cab chassis only
